Output 858209c84fa010aad8ffbced65166ae29efc32c9f031fcb23d69d2fc0ca14198:0

value
22402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82e1df33c74b4bf1874802c2c8da3e1bc0869625 OP_EQUAL
address
3Dd4MLQJFe8pRwawyA13eocEc8FamAhj1e
transaction
858209c84fa010aad8ffbced65166ae29efc32c9f031fcb23d69d2fc0ca14198
confirmations
30803
spent
false